Table of ContentsReviewsAuthor InformationGrandmaster Raymond Keene is a former British champion, and the most prolific chess author ever, has more than 100 books to his credit. He not only is one of the most widely-read authors, with sales exceeding one million books, but a widely popular chess columnist for the Spectator (London) and London Times. He was the co-author, with Garry Kasparov and Eric Schiller, of Batsford Chess Openings, the all-time best-selling opening reference book. Tab Content 6Author Website:Countries AvailableAll regions |
